Brian Whitaker of The Guardian argues that the fighting on Israeli’s northern border is the fault of Israeli Prime Minter Ariel Sharon. This ignores the actions of the Hezbollah in the kidnap / murder of Sgt. Adi Avitan, Staff Sgt. Binyamin Avraham, Staff Sgt. Omar Souad of Salma on October 7, 2000, prior to his election. He states that the rocket attacks against Israel are harmless, ignoring a whole family that were injured when a rocket hit their home in Rajar.

More importantly is the question, if Israel withdraws to United Nations sanctioned borders as in Lebanon and the attacks continue why would Israel have any confidence that any further withdraws with not result in the same thing. You this Brian Whitaker has no answers, any hatred of Israel.

MSNBC.com has a much more accurate account of the situation.
